Each week, we talk to leading experts about the issues shaping women's health in midlife. From hormone therapy and weight management to sexual health and more, these conversations take a comprehensive look at the whole woman, exploring the latest science and practical steps women can take to support their long-term health and well-being.   • Weight Management During Midlife: The Role of Hormones
    Jul 16 2026

    Weight gain is one of the biggest frustrations women experience during menopause, but it's about more than the number on the scale. In this episode, Dr. Doug Lucas explains how hormonal changes affect weight and metabolism, why maintaining a healthy weight becomes more challenging during midlife, and the role nutrition, exercise, hormone therapy, and GLP-1 medications can play.

  • The Menopause Conversation Every Woman Should Have
    Jul 9 2026

    Hormonal changes during perimenopause and menopause can affect everything from mood and sleep to brain, bone, and heart health. Yet many women aren't sure what symptoms to expect, when to seek care, or whether hormone therapy is right for them. In this episode, Dr. Karen Koffler, Clinical Chair of Women's Health and Integrative Medicine at LifeMD, Director of Integrative and Functional Medicine at Miami Whole Health, and Professor at the University of Miami School of Medicine, explains what happens during perimenopause and menopause, how the conversation around hormone therapy has evolved, and why personalized care can make all the difference in how you feel.

  • Hormones, Health, and Midlife: Looking at the Whole Picture
    Jul 2 2026

    Hormones influence nearly every system in the body, affecting everything from bone health and metabolism to sleep, cognition, and sexual health. Yet many women don't realize just how central hormones are to their overall health, particularly during midlife. In this episode, Dr. Doug Lucas, Clinical Lead of Hormone Optimization and Longevity at LifeMD, explains why taking a whole-woman approach to health is essential during midlife, how hormones shape long-term health, and why access to quality providers and personalized care matters.
